Brabecke is a locality in the municipality Schmallenberg in the district Hochsauerlandkreis in North Rhine-Westphalia, Germany. The village has 194 inhabitants and lies in the north of the municipality of Schmallenberg at a height of around 141 m. Brabecke is situated 3 km west of Schwabenberg.
